This category features original antique views and prints of the Northern Territory, depicting its distinctive landscapes, coastal regions and frontier settlements. Works in this category offer historic visual documentation of a region known for its remote terrain, tropical washes and early contact scenes between Indigenous communities and European explorers.
Many prints derive from field sketches made during exploration, surveying and travel in the 19th century, later reproduced as engravings or lithographs for publication in atlases, travel narratives and illustrated geographic works. They capture rivers, escarpments, camps, foreshore scenes and nascent township developments.
Antique views of the Northern Territory are prized for their rarity, scenic depth and capacity to convey a frontier environment that was challenging to access and represent. As original works on paper, they provide collectors and historians with insight into early encounters and geographic character of Australia’s Top End.
